This alignment is particularly significant for DePIN and real-world AI applications, where institutional participation-such as custody solutions and institutional-grade data infrastructure-is essential for scaling adoption.IoTeX's infrastructure is uniquely designed to support DePIN and real-world AI initiatives, leveraging its modular architecture to process verifiable data from physical devices. Components like ioID (machine authentication), Quicksilver (real-time data aggregation), and W3bstream (off-chain proof generation) enable AI agents to operate on authenticated, real-world inputs
. These tools are already being deployed in energy grids, smart cities, and logistics networks, where AI-driven decision-making relies on secure, decentralized data streams.For example,
